js 高阶函数 map reduce
2024-10-18 22:38:00
map()
var arr = [1,3,4];
function a(x){
return x*x;
}
//map可以将一个函数作为参数执行,将数组中的值,依次使用a函数处理;
return arr.map(a); //[1,9,16]
reduce()
//reduce()函数有两个参数;
var arr = [1,4,5,6]; function a(x,y){
return x+y;
}
//reduce传入两个参数,每计算的值与下一个参数再次运算,
arr.reduce(a);//
最新文章
- 你真的会玩SQL吗?无处不在的子查询
- 双守护进程(不死service)-5.0系统以下
- 1019: [SHOI2008]汉诺塔
- Apache 配置 WebSocket 协议
- python课程第二周重点记录
- PHP--浏览器禁用cookie后,怎么使用session
- HDU 1247 Hat's Words (map+string)
- 你不知道的JavaScript--DOM基础详解2
- 开启mysql慢查询日志并使用mysqldumpslow命令查看
- hdu3033I love sneakers! (分组背包,错了很多次)
- python字符串操作总结
- JavaScript(第十一天)【变量,作用域,内存】
- 光纤网卡与HBA卡区别
- if(){}使用
- 全网Star最多(近20k)的Spring Boot开源教程 2019 年要继续更新了!
- zookeeper集群配置详细教程
- (网页)table加上分页,优点可随便加样式
- SQLi Lab的视频教程和文字教程
- foxmail占cpu 100%解决办法
- WritePrivateProfileString、GetPrivateProfileString 读写配置文件